You may know the Coker Group for an impressive lineup of brands that includes Coker, Zip Products, and Corvette Central. What you might not know is that the Coker Group has a rich history of hosting epic automotive events, including The Great Race, a renowned time, speed, and endurance rally for vintage vehicles. This year, Coker is partnering with Corvettes at Carlisle to kick off The Ultimate Corvette Tour.
From August 22nd through August 29th, Corvette owners have the chance to trade their garages for the open highway during a seven-day celebration of America’s favorite sports car. The high-end road trip caters to enthusiasts who value time behind the wheel, featuring hundreds of miles of exciting blacktop and multiple VIP experiences at private car collections, historic museums, and more. The adventure begins at Corvette Central’s headquarters in Sawyer, Michigan, and crosses the country to Corvettes at Carlisle, where participants will enjoy special parking and a full weekend of fun activities.

While The Great Race is considered a competitive event, The Ultimate Corvette Tour will be more relaxed, with plenty of great roads, preplanned VIP experiences, and camaraderie. The official route winds through Michigan, Indiana, and Ohio before crossing the Pennsylvania border to join the largest Corvette gathering in the world.
The cost to join The Ultimate Corvette Tour is $7,999. That sum gets participants one hotel room in each city, meals for two, VIP access to private collections, behind-the-scenes museum experiences, and other cool experiences throughout the tour. The registration fee also covers entry into Corvettes at Carlisle and a hotel that’s only half a mile from the show’s Fun Field.
